Are the exercises gender-specific?
It is completely wrong to think of the training as gender-specific. Both exercises can be performed by men and women for the same purpose. The difference between the two is their intensity because naturally, men have stronger muscles than women. This is why professionals are needed to recommend the correct intensity of training for each gender.
